Output 28affde36f0261a98032f66ca8f7b3ecfdb259776f4023db65ae8147cbe28a15:70

value
42196000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17900039842c02f139c44a3bedc5fd1af9ec397 OP_EQUAL
address
MNcwyYdHTgUfTEUZ2FvCj5oPDb6BWuekVc
transaction
28affde36f0261a98032f66ca8f7b3ecfdb259776f4023db65ae8147cbe28a15
spent
true